[DwarfEhPrepare] Assign dummy debug location for inserted _Unwind_Resume calls (PR57469)
DwarfEhPrepare inserts calls to _Unwind_Resume into landing pads. If _Unwind_Resume happens to be defined in the same module and debug info is used, then this leads to a verifier error: inlinable function call in a function with debug info must have a !dbg location call void @_Unwind_Resume(ptr %exn.obj) #0 Fix this by assigning a dummy location to the call. (As this happens in the backend, inlining is not actually relevant here.) Fixes https://github.com/llvm/llvm-project/issues/57469.
